On Tuesday March 25th we were at the center Joaquín Roncal and we visited the exhibition project Kohtaamisia carried out by ten Aragonese painters. The project immersed in new imaging technologies uses the e-mail art as a tool for artistic communication. 

As we explained, the curators of the exhibition Carmen Perez-Ramirez and Pilar Catalán, President and Vice President of ADCA, Kohtaamisia is much more than the perfect union between the Finnish painter Helene Schjerfbeck and speaking Swedish poet Edith Södergran, Kohtaamisia symbolizes women's encounters with women, with men, with children, with themselves, with love and with the earth.
